The Professional Certificate in Fluid Mechanics and Heat Exchangers is a comprehensive program designed to equip learners with the knowledge and skills required to design, operate, and maintain fluid mechanics and heat exchanger systems in various industries.
This certificate program covers a wide range of topics, including fluid mechanics, heat transfer, thermodynamics, and heat exchanger design, ensuring that learners gain a deep understanding of the fundamental principles and concepts in the field.
Upon completion of the program, learners can expect to achieve the following learning outcomes:
they will be able to apply fluid mechanics and heat transfer principles to real-world problems,
they will be able to design and optimize heat exchanger systems for maximum efficiency,
they will be able to analyze and troubleshoot fluid mechanics and heat exchanger systems,
they will be able to communicate effectively with engineers and technicians in the field.
The duration of the Professional Certificate in Fluid Mechanics and Heat Exchangers is typically 12 weeks, with learners completing a series of online modules and assignments that are designed to be completed at their own pace.
The program is highly relevant to the energy and process industries, where fluid mechanics and heat exchanger systems play a critical role in the production of power, chemicals, and other products.
